Name Pipe Dreams 3D
Platform PlayStation
Year 2001
Genre Puzzle
Publisher Empire Interactive
Sales in North America 80,000
Sales in Europe 50,000
Sales in Japan 0
Sales in the rest of the world 10,000
Total Global Sales 140,000
